33:1 |
"But now, Job, listen to my words; pay attention to everything I say.
|
33:2 |
I am about to open my mouth; my words are on the tip of my tongue.
|
33:3 |
My words come from an upright heart; my lips sincerely speak what I know.
|
33:4 |
The Spirit of God has made me; the breath of the Almighty gives me life.
|
33:5 |
Answer me then, if you can; prepare yourself and confront me.
|
33:6 |
I am just like you before God; I too have been taken from clay.
|
33:7 |
No fear of me should alarm you, nor should my hand be heavy upon you.
|
33:8 |
"But you have said in my hearing-- I heard the very words--
|
33:9 |
`I am pure and without sin; I am clean and free from guilt.
|
33:10 |
Yet God has found fault with me; he considers me his enemy.
|
33:11 |
He fastens my feet in shackles; he keeps close watch on all my paths.
|
33:12 |
"'But I tell you, in this you are not right, for God is greater than man.
|
33:13 |
Why do you complain to him that he answers none of man's words?
|
33:14 |
For God does speak--now one way, now another-- though man may not perceive it.
|
33:15 |
In a dream, in a vision of the night, when deep sleep falls on men as they slumber in their beds,
|
33:16 |
he may speak in their ears and terrify them with warnings,
|
33:17 |
to turn man from wrongdoing and keep him from pride,
|
33:18 |
to preserve his soul from the pit, his life from perishing by the sword.
|
33:19 |
Or a man may be chastened on a bed of pain with constant distress in his bones,
|
33:20 |
so that his very being finds food repulsive and his soul loathes the choicest meal.
|
33:21 |
His flesh wastes away to nothing, and his bones, once hidden, now stick out.
|
33:22 |
His soul draws near to the pit, and his life to the messengers of death.
|
33:23 |
"Yet if there is an angel on his side as a mediator, one out of a thousand, to tell a man what is right for him,
|
33:24 |
to be gracious to him and say, `Spare him from going down to the pit; I have found a ransom for him'--
|
33:25 |
then his flesh is renewed like a child's; it is restored as in the days of his youth.
|
33:26 |
He prays to God and finds favor with him, he sees God's face and shouts for joy; he is restored by God to his righteous state.
|
33:27 |
Then he comes to men and says, `I sinned, and perverted what was right, but I did not get what I deserved.
|
33:28 |
He redeemed my soul from going down to the pit, and I will live to enjoy the light.
|
33:29 |
"'God does all these things to a man-- twice, even three times--
|
33:30 |
to turn back his soul from the pit, that the light of life may shine on him.
|
33:31 |
"Pay attention, Job, and listen to me; be silent, and I will speak.
|
33:32 |
If you have anything to say, answer me; speak up, for I want you to be cleared.
|
33:33 |
But if not, then listen to me; be silent, and I will teach you wisdom."
